Learning Management Systems (LMS) have revolutionized how education is delivered in this digital era, making it more accessible, flexible, and engaging. The rise in the adoption of LMS during the pandemic shows its transformative influence on teaching and learning as more satisfaction, improved productivity, and increased student engagement occur. If you are planning to develop an LMS using WordPress, understanding the cost factors and development process is key to informed decisions. This blog will help explore key features, factors affecting the costs, and the general pricing structure in creating a strong WordPress LMS.
Core features of Learning Management system that affects COST
When you decide to develop a learning management system using WordPress, here’re a few core features that are must and affect the cost of your WordPress LMS venture:
- Course builder One of the essential features of any WordPress LMS is to allow the users to create different courses. Starting from basic quizzes to complex courses, it should enable the end-user to create various courses.
- Content managementUsing this feature, you can allow the end-users to create various meaningful content for the students or learners.
- Skill assessment and testingThe course builder should also enable a proper skill assessment tool to validate the learners’ knowledge.
- Statistics, Achievements, and SurveysA well-developed LMS should help you with the key statistics about your LMS along with a progress tracker, surveys, and a lot more.
- Mobile supportIt is essential to design LMS to make it accessible across all the devices. The Mobile version helps you bring flexibility for the learners to opt for courses on the go.
- NotificationsYour LMs should notify learners about the latest courses, updates, or about a specific program in the form of simple text, images, and action buttons.
To accommodate the core features in the LMS, you will roughly require 50-100 hrs. Apart from the features or functionalities, many other factors can affect the cost of WordPress LMS, which are listed below.
Want to build your own LMS? Let’s create it with our eLearning development team.
Pooja Upadhyay
Director Of People Operations & Client Relations
Factors that affect the cost of WordPress LMS
Discovery and market research – This activity involves market research, user personas, and market capitalization, which roughly involves 40-80 hrs.
Analysis and scoping – This phase involve identifying the complexities involved in the LMS, which is indirectly dependent on the kind of LMS features you are trying to integrate into your WordPress LMS. Based on the complexity of your LMS, it may take somewhere around 40-100 hrs.
Design & Animation – The next factor that contributes to the cost of developing LMS using WordPress is design and animation. It will roughly take 50-80 hrs.
Implementing front-end and back-end functionalities – Usually, the front-end and back-end functionality implementation may take up to 50-100 hrs.
Integration & testing – You might require integrating payment gateways and other third-party applications to your LMS and performing testing. It will take somewhere around 60 hrs.
Location of the WordPress development company you hire –The per-hour rate may vary from $18 to $150 per hour, based on the agency’s location.
Team for WordPress LMS
Depending on who develops your WordPress LMS, whether an individual developer or a known WordPress development company, the cost vary. There is a considerable amount of cost difference based on the team size. Your WordPress LMS development maybe consist of the following team structure:
So, there you have it!
To build WordPress LMS, all you will need is a list of features, hosting, theme, plugins, and a trusted WordPress development agency. There is nothing called a proven “Formula” that can help you know how much you will be spending on developing an online learning management system. However, to summarize the cost of developing WordPress LMS, consider the following cost breakup:
- 40-100 hours to carry out market research, business analysis, and scope.
- 40-100 hours to design platform architecture
- 50-80 hours for designing and wireframing
- 50-100 hours for front-end and back-end development
- 40 hours to perform integration with 3rd party applications
- 20 hours to perform quality checks
This will add up to somewhere around 400-500 hours to develop a fully functional learning management system with the help of WordPress.
The total cost may vary somewhere around $10K to $15K for your WordPress LMS. But it may go higher if you opt for additional tools.
How can AddWeb Solution help?
Whether you are looking for a fully customized WordPress LMS or a ready-to-use application to roll out courses online, AddWeb Solution possesses enough technical expertise and business know-how. We provide strong and long-term collaboration to bring more flexibility and scalability to your LMS. Hire expert WordPress developers from professional WordPress development company for your LMS needs.
Conclusion
Building a WordPress LMS is an investment in combining advanced functionality with user-centric design, which produces the most impactful eLearning experiences. Total cost development varies based on features, design, and team expertise, but the right-planned WordPress LMS provides a huge return in terms of learner engagement and revenue growth. With AddWeb Solution, you can smoothly develop a customized LMS aligned with your specific educational needs. Let’s turn your vision into a dynamic learning platform that will meet your needs and exceed your expectations!
Frequently Asked Questions
The cost of building an LMS with WordPress depends on factors such as the desired features, customization requirements, user interface design, integration with third-party tools, and the complexity of the content structure.
Using existing LMS plugins can be more cost-effective initially, but a custom solution offers greater flexibility and scalability. The choice depends on specific project requirements and long-term goals.
The number of users can affect development costs, especially regarding scalability and performance optimization. Larger user bases require more robust infrastructure, impacting overall project costs.
Features such as user management, course creation tools, multimedia content support, assessment modules, and analytics capabilities can contribute to the overall cost. The more advanced and customized the features, the higher the development cost.
Yes, the choice of hosting can affect costs. Shared hosting is more affordable but may not provide the performance needed for an LMS. Dedicated or cloud hosting options may incur additional charges but offer better scalability and performance.
High levels of customization, including unique design elements, custom functionalities, and integrations with external systems, can increase development costs. Balancing customization with essential features is vital for cost-effectiveness.
Ongoing costs include hosting fees, maintenance, updates, and potential support services. It’s crucial to factor in these ongoing costs for the continued functionality and security of the WordPress LMS.
Want to Build a Learning Management System at Affordable Prices?
Want to Build a Learning Management System at Affordable Prices?
Pooja Upadhyay
Director Of People Operations & Client Relations